We have studied the dielectric properties of the ferromagnetic spinel CdCr2S4 from first principles. Zone-center phonons and Born effective charges were calculated by frozen-phonon and Berry phase techniques within LSDA+U. We find that all infrared-active phonons are quite stable within the cubic space group. The calculated static dielectric constant agrees well with previous measurements. These results suggest that the recently observed anomalous dielectric behavior in CdCr2S4 is not due to the softening of a polar mode. We suggest further experiments to clarify this point.
